The Effect of Information Personal Privacy Laws on Conversion Tracking
Tracking conversions lets you determine the performance of your marketing and advertising. It also enables you to recognize just how close your customers are to reaching a goal and take steps to reach it.
Nevertheless, information personal privacy laws like GDPR and CCPA have developed obstacles for online marketers attempting to make use of personal information for conversion monitoring. This has forced marketers to discover methods to track conversions while continuing to be certified.

The golden state's CCPA
The The Golden State Customer Personal Privacy Act, or CCPA, provides consumers more control over exactly how companies use their personal information. It relates to firms that associate with The golden state homeowners and fulfill specific requirements. These include generating more than $25 million in annual earnings or taking care of the individual info of 100,000 or more California residents. Firms do not need to be based in California and even have a physical existence there to be impacted mobile user engagement analytics by the law.
The law consists of a vast interpretation of individual info, including geolocation information, on-line searching history, and other details. In addition, it bans web sites from discriminating against users who exercise their civil liberties.

Ohio's HB 376
While Ohio's regulation is not best and undoubtedly has some unintentional consequences, it strikes a far better balance than many various other state information privacy regimens. For instance, by vesting enforcement authority in the Attorney general of the United States, it avoids developing untidy and expensive exclusive legal rights of action that can hinder innovation companies from using their services.
It additionally offers an affirmative defense to services whose privacy programs sensibly adapt with the National Institute of Criteria and Modern technology's Privacy Framework. And it enables consumers to inform business not to market their data.
But HB 376 neglects the most vital aspect for understanding these advantages: explicit and detailed opt-in requirements. Such needs are important for making certain that people have meaningful control over their personal information and decrease the "opt-out" situations where it's essential to research study, call, and navigate the procedures of each private firm or company they run into. GDPR
GDPR needs companies to acquire consent from site visitors before gathering information, and it restricts tracking site visitor behavior on internet sites. Those that don't conform face stiff monetary penalties and reputational damage.
This guideline applies to the individual details of citizens in the European Economic Location, regardless of where it's gathered or stored. Consequently, it has to be followed by any kind of site that brings in visitors from the EU.
The policy mentions that businesses can just accumulate personal info if there is a lawful justification, such as approval (Recital 47), agreement, legal responsibility, essential interests or public task. In addition, personal info needs to only be kept for as long as needed worrying the purpose it was initially accumulated. It also needs that companies be clear about what they're making with information and give users the capability to accessibility, correct, or remove it at any moment. It additionally demands that companies inform authorities and influenced people within 72 hours of discovering a safety violation.
